When Tanning Masters is taken in by Sir Wilfred Masters, he is trained to be a business accountant in England—but a grand adventure awaits him far beyond England’s shores. As Tan grows up, he is sent first to France, and then to a remote trading post in Rupert’s Land to work for the Hudson’s Bay Company. In the rough Canadian West, Tan’s skills as a gunsmith and blacksmith prove useful. However, when his old enemy arrives and begins pillaging the land, Tan quickly finds himself in a precarious position—and on the run from a dangerous criminal.

After a harrowing accident leaves him stranded, Tan finds a place where he can build his life anew. But will his enemy find him again? How will Tan obtain his inheritance and cause it to increase?

About the Author

E.R. Nicodemus was born in Dawson Creek, British Columbia. His hobbies include pioneering and canoeing, and he holds a diploma in Forestry Technology. His cultural and linguistic studies of indigenous peoples during missions training has helped him in his twenty-five years of experience. His home is in Moncton, New Brunswick.
